本文围绕“TPWallet换图标”这一可视化操作入口,延展探讨其背后可能涉及的产品能力与链上/链下协同逻辑。为便于理解,我们将讨论拆分为:便捷资产存取、智能合约、专业洞悉、高效能市场支付应用、区块头、数据保管六个模块,并把“换图标”当作用户触点与系统能力映射的切面:当图标发生变化,用户体验如何变得更清晰,系统如何保持一致性与安全性。

一、便捷资产存取:从“换图标”到“更快识别”

资产存取的效率,往往先取决于用户的识别成本。钱包端常见的摩擦包括:资产图标不一致、币种/代币被错误归类、网络切换后显示延迟等。通过“换图标”,产品在界面层完成了两件事:
1)降低误操作:当代币与链网络对应关系更清晰,用户在发送、收款、兑换时更不易选错资产。
2)提升路径可预期性:图标与品牌化视觉能帮助用户在多链环境中快速锁定目标。
进一步看,若TPWallet的“换图标”功能支持自定义或由资源库更新,则还会涉及资产元数据同步策略:图标更新需要与代币合约地址、链ID、符号(symbol)等信息严格绑定,避免出现“图标换了但代币未变/或元数据未更新”的一致性问题。
二、智能合约:图标背后的合约标识与校验
“换图标”表面是UI,但深层仍会触及合约域:
1)代币元数据来源:图标通常来自链上tokenURI、Token标准字段、或链下资源库。若依赖链上元数据,则需要解析合约返回的数据并处理缓存、超时与回退。
2)校验与安全:即便是图标,也应避免被恶意元数据“投毒”。例如,同一合约在不同链上可能表现不同;或同一符号在不同合约中并不等价。钱包需要用“合约地址+链ID”作为主键,而不是仅靠symbol。
3)交易与授权的关系:在用户更改图标后,钱包依然必须保证后续的签名、授权额度、路由交换路径与合约调用不受UI影响。换图标不应改变签名消息内容,仅是显示层更换。
三、专业洞悉:可追溯的资产表现与可解释的状态
“专业洞悉”意味着:用户不仅看到图标,还能理解“图标为何出现、对应的资产状态如何”。可通过以下能力增强可信度:
1)来源说明:图标来自链上还是资源库?是自定义还是官方更新?可在详情页提供可解释提示。
2)状态一致性:当网络拥堵、RPC失败或数据未刷新时,图标应标记“可能延迟”,避免误导。
3)风险提示:若代币合约疑似权限过大(如可增发、可修改元数据)、或合约与已知风险标签匹配,则在资产列表以更显著的方式呈现图标/徽标,帮助用户做更理性的决策。
四、高效能市场支付应用:换图标与支付效率的联动
高效能市场支付应用强调“快速完成交易闭环”。图标在其中扮演“减少沟通成本”的角色:
1)收付款识别:商家或市场平台若在订单页展示某种支付代币,钱包端通过统一图标可减少用户在多币种支付时的判断时间。
2)路由与估值展示:当用户选择不同代币作为支付货币时,钱包需要实时显示价格影响、滑点与手续费。此处图标的准确性会影响用户对“支付成本”的直觉判断。
3)批量与快捷操作:若支持一键支付/常用地址缓存,图标可作为“快捷入口”的视觉索引。系统应确保批量签名或批量转账时,图标与实际转账目标一致。
五、区块头:链上可验证与同步策略
“区块头”代表链上数据的时间锚与可验证状态。对于钱包而言,即便主要是展示层换图标,也需要依赖链的同步机制:
1)确定性同步:图标元数据或代币状态的刷新,可能需要与某个区块高度对齐,避免在不同高度获取到不一致的结果。
2)确认与重组处理:在区块重组或短时分叉时,钱包应基于确认数做最终性处理。否则可能出现“交易未确认时UI已更新”的错觉。
3)性能优化:区块头信息可用于减少重复拉取、提升缓存命中率。比如,以区块高度为key刷新元数据缓存,使图标更新更稳定。
六、数据保管:本地缓存、隐私与密钥安全
数据保管是钱包长期体验与合规可信的核心。围绕换图标的实现,常见关注点包括:
1)元数据缓存安全:图标文件与元数据应做完整性校验(hash校验或来源可信校验),防止被替换或污染。
2)隐私最小化:换图标不应引导收集不必要的用户标识。若需要上传或同步偏好(例如自定义图标),应明确数据范围并采取脱敏与最小存储策略。
3)密钥隔离:钱包的私钥/助记词/会话密钥必须保持在安全存储区。UI层的图标与缓存不应拥有读取敏感数据的权限。
4)可恢复与迁移:若用户更换设备或重装应用,自定义图标与资产列表应可通过安全备份恢复,且恢复流程不改变链上签名逻辑。
结语:换图标不是“换皮”,而是“信任界面”的重塑
综上,TPWallet换图标可以被视为一个面向用户的入口,它承接了便捷资产存取的识别需求,也依赖智能合约与元数据校验来保证资产归属准确。进一步,它还连接到专业洞悉的可解释展示、高效能市场支付应用的交易效率,以及区块头相关的同步与最终性策略。最后,数据保管确保整个过程不会牺牲隐私与密钥安全。
当产品把“视觉一致性”与“链上可验证一致性”同时做到位,用户体验才真正从“好看”走向“可信、快速、可控”。
评论
Kaiyu_7
换图标看起来只是UI优化,但你把链上校验、缓存一致性和区块头同步都讲到点子上了,很有产品视角。
小岚岚
文章把“图标=资产归属的可信信号”讲清楚了,尤其是别仅靠symbol的那段,避免误操作的意义很大。
NovaZen
对数据保管和隐私最小化的讨论很实用:图标缓存也要做完整性校验,安全意识到位。
陈风起
“高效能市场支付应用”那部分写得挺像真实业务:收付款识别效率确实会影响成交速度。
MinaClover
如果换图标会涉及tokenURI解析,那就必须考虑重组/确认数,不然状态错乱体验会很差。
ByteWander
我喜欢你把换图标当作信任界面的重塑来总结,逻辑闭环完整,读完很有方向感。